Mold in S-Shaped Airlock
I'm new to homebrewing, and I've recently encountered a problem with an s-shaped airlock. I clean it out with water after use, but it takes forever to dry on its own. This time, it's started growing mold inside after washing it out. Is there some way to dry out the airlock to prevent this sort of mold growth? I imagine if I cleaned it out with vodka or something similar, it would prevent such growth, but I'd prefer to clean with water, because it's essentially free.
